linux操作指令训练,实验二linux 常用命令练习

一、使用简单的命令:date,cal,who,echo,clear等,了解linux命令格式。

1.date系列命令,用来显示日期:

linux操作指令训练,实验二linux 常用命令练习_第1张图片    2.cal系列命令,用来显示日历:

linux操作指令训练,实验二linux 常用命令练习_第2张图片

linux操作指令训练,实验二linux 常用命令练习_第3张图片

3.who系列命令,用来显示用户:

linux操作指令训练,实验二linux 常用命令练习_第4张图片

4.echo系列命令,用来输出:

linux操作指令训练,实验二linux 常用命令练习_第5张图片

f804ad0c9b3866173edb5a4da22adb70.png

5.clear,即清屏。

二、浏览文件系统:

1.运行pwd命令,确定当前工作目录:

032ba61152d557cd95e35264e00bc33e.png

2.运行ls -l命令,理解各字段的含义:

linux操作指令训练,实验二linux 常用命令练习_第6张图片

其中d表示目录文件,-表示普通文件;r表示读权限,w表示写权限,x表示可执行权限,-表示无权限;三组分别表示所有者权限,组用户权限,其他用户权限。

3.运行ls -ai命令,理解各字段的含义:

linux操作指令训练,实验二linux 常用命令练习_第7张图片

数字表示文件的I节点号,所列出的前两项分别表示当前目录和其父目录。

4.使用cd命令,将工作目录改到根/上,运行ls -l命令,了解各目录的作用。

linux操作指令训练,实验二linux 常用命令练习_第8张图片

5.直接使用cd,回到home下的用户目录,用pwd验证。

linux操作指令训练,实验二linux 常用命令练习_第9张图片

6.用mkdir建立一个子目录sudir:

ccbe4834713bd442c39bac4e58d9c303.png

7.将工作目录改到subdir

711b9594070cdd5b42a4929bab898d28.png三、文件操作

1.验证当前工作目录在subdir

774a23d68b95e34a897ea59aeec84be4.png

2.运行date>file1,然后运行cat file1:

d58c4afd0c1fe8dff40030a835d9f423.png    >是覆盖原有内容,date覆盖file1的内容,再用cat读取,就是读取了日期。

3.运行 cat subdir

9e1decd7de08a4f3bc41dcccda91ca21.png

因为cat只能显示文件不能显示目录,subdir是目录。

4.用man命令显示date命令的使用说明:

linux操作指令训练,实验二linux 常用命令练习_第10张图片

5.运行man date>>file1,再运行cat file1

linux操作指令训练,实验二linux 常用命令练习_第11张图片

因为>>是追加在文本末尾的意思,在file1后面追加了man date,即date的使用方法。

6.利用ls -l file1了解链接计数是多少,运行ln file1 ../fa,再运行ls -l file1,观察链接数有无变化?用cat命令显示fa文件内容:

026651ead6be278b350db87fced9dac8.png

linux操作指令训练,实验二linux 常用命令练习_第12张图片

因为ln把file1和fa连接起来了。

7.显示file1的前10行,后10行:

linux操作指令训练,实验二linux 常用命令练习_第13张图片

8.运行cp file1 file2,然后运行ls -l,看到什么?运行mv file2 file3,然后运行ls -l,看到什么?运行cat f*,结果如何?

linux操作指令训练,实验二linux 常用命令练习_第14张图片

cp是拷贝命令。

b27f5c122271935f26f7b00eb9f04c14.png

mv命令用来移动文件及目录或者重命名文件及目录

linux操作指令训练,实验二linux 常用命令练习_第15张图片

9.运行rm file3,然后ls -l

815cb959997cd5dbe826dc9b783f219f.png

rm是删除命令

10.在/etc/passwd文件中查找注册名的行

linux操作指令训练,实验二linux 常用命令练习_第16张图片

11.运行ls -l,理解各文件的权限是什么

linux操作指令训练,实验二linux 常用命令练习_第17张图片

解释同二.2

12.用两种方式改变file1的权限:

linux操作指令训练,实验二linux 常用命令练习_第18张图片

利用 chmod 可以藉以控制档案如何被他人所调用。o表示对其他用户,a表示对所有用户,g表示对同组的用户,+表示增加权限,-表示减少权限,r表示可读权限,w表示可写权限,x表示可执行权限。

13.统计file1文件的行数和字数

f4d4def23160135f21e73de68cc13e0d.png

14.运行man ls|more,结果是?运行cat file1|head -20|tee file5,结果是?运行cat file5|wc,结果是?

linux操作指令训练,实验二linux 常用命令练习_第19张图片

这是ls使用说明,因为用了more所以一行一行显示。

linux操作指令训练,实验二linux 常用命令练习_第20张图片

这是把file1显示头20行,tee file5表示重定向到file5

a5d5c065d5626e74735df2d70e4a77a3.png

file5是被重定向的file1,wc是统计。

四、实验总结

通过这次实验,我对linux命令的了解更深刻了,学会了更多命令的使用方法,初窥到linux命令的门径,里面是浩大的海洋。简单的命令通过不同的组合可以实现千变万化的功能,让人叹为观止。需要学习的东西还很多,我还需要更多的努力。

你可能感兴趣的:(linux操作指令训练)